Question
Factor the expression
Factor
(x+2)(5x+3)
Evaluate
5x2+13x+6
Rewrite the expression
5x2+(3+10)x+6
Calculate
5x2+3x+10x+6
Rewrite the expression
x×5x+x×3+2×5x+2×3
Factor out x from the expression
x(5x+3)+2×5x+2×3
Factor out 2 from the expression
x(5x+3)+2(5x+3)
Solution
(x+2)(5x+3)
